Learning about UK Online Casino Licensing and Regulation
The United Kingdom Gambling Commission serves as the main regulatory body supervising all gaming operations within the country, creating detailed guidelines that operators must meet to lawfully provide services to British players. This independent organization provides licenses solely to operators who show financial strength, implement robust player protection measures, and maintain open business practices. Any licensed casino targeting UK residents must show their UKGC license number prominently on their website, typically in the footer section, allowing players to check authenticity directly through the Commission’s public register.
Licensed operators encounter strict ongoing compliance requirements including regular audits, financial reporting obligations, and adherence to advertising standards that prohibit the targeting of vulnerable individuals or minors. The regulatory framework requires that casinos implement self-exclusion programs, spending caps, and reality checks to encourage responsible gaming practices among their customers. Failure to maintain these standards results in significant fines, license suspension, or permanent license cancellation, ensuring operators stay responsible for their conduct and the safeguards they offer to players throughout their gaming experience.
Beyond the UKGC license, established casinos often hold extra credentials from external verification bodies such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, or GLI, which ensure that gaming software functions with fairness and RNG systems produce truly random outcomes. These external reviews examine payout percentages, game fairness, and security standards, providing an additional level of confidence that the casino operates with integrity. Players should look for certifications and badges from established auditors shown with licensing information, as this pairing demonstrates a focus on accountability and player protection that surpasses minimum regulatory requirements established by licensing organizations.

Secure Socket Layer encryption and Information Security
Secure Socket Layer (SSL) encryption serves as the gold standard for safeguarding data transferred between your device and the gaming platform’s servers. This system scrambles personal details such as passwords, account credentials, and personal identification, making it extremely difficult for unauthorized parties to intercept. You can verify SSL encryption by looking for the lock symbol in your browser’s address bar, and verifying the URL starts with “https” rather than “http”.
Top-tier casinos employ 128-bit or 256-bit SSL encryption, the identical security standard used by major financial institutions worldwide. Additionally, strong data protection policies guarantee your personal data is stored securely and not shared with outside organizations without clear approval. Regular security audits and compliance with privacy laws further demonstrate a casino’s commitment to protecting player confidentiality.
Game Fairness and RNG Compliance
Random Number Generator (RNG) certification guarantees that game outcomes are genuinely random and cannot be manipulated by the casino or players. Autonomous auditing firms such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and GLI consistently evaluate casino games to validate their fairness and correct RNG deployment. These certifications deliver mathematical verification that every spin, deal, or draw generates unpredictable outcomes with accurate odds.
Reputable gaming sites prominently display their RNG certificates and testing reports, often in the footer of their websites or fairness verification sections. Look for current audit timestamps and verification seals from recognized testing agencies. Some operators also display RTP (RTP) percentages for their games, demonstrating their commitment to transparency and allowing players to select games wisely about which games to play.
Responsible Gaming Tools
Full-featured responsible gambling features demonstrate that a casino prioritizes player wellbeing over profits. Important tools include deposit limits, loss restrictions, gaming session alerts, and self-exclusion options that allow players to control their gaming activity. These features should be readily available from your account settings and take effect immediately or within a suitable period once activated.
Beyond foundational safety tools, reputable casinos provide links to established support groups such as GamCare, BeGambleAware, and Gamblers Anonymous. Reality check notifications, cooling-off intervals, and access to gaming activity records help players stay informed of their habits. The availability of trained personnel skilled at recognizing problematic gaming patterns and active dialogue about responsible gaming additionally demonstrate a casino’s genuine commitment to patron safety.
Verifying a Casino Regulatory Credentials
Before registering at any online casino, checking the licensing credentials should be your top priority. Legitimate operators showcase their license information prominently in the website footer, typically including the license number and the regulatory body. The UK Gambling Commission stands as the gold standard for regulatory oversight, ensuring operators meet rigorous standards for fair play, security, and player protection. You can confirm any license by accessing the regulator’s official portal and comparing the details provided.
Beyond simply spotting a license logo, take time to understand what distinct regions offer in terms of player safeguards. Licenses from Malta, Gibraltar, and the Isle of Man also deliver comprehensive security, though each has unique regulations. Be wary of casinos licensed in minimally supervised regions, as these may not offer adequate dispute resolution mechanisms or financial safeguards. Always ensure the license is current and hasn’t been withdrawn or cancelled.
Red flags consist of missing license information, unclear compliance claims, or operators declining to share verification details when asked. Some fraudulent sites display fake badges or reference expired licenses to seem credible. If you cannot independently confirm a casino’s licensing status through official channels, it’s best to avoid that platform entirely. Remember that playing at unlicensed casinos means losing protections and remedies when disputes arise.

Withdrawal Processes and Timeframes
Understanding how to withdraw funds helps prevent disappointment when claiming your winnings from reputable casino platforms. Most operators request personal verification before handling initial withdrawals, typically requesting documents like ID documents or proof of address. This identity check, while potentially slow, safeguards against scams and maintains adherence with anti-money laundering regulations throughout the gaming world.
Processing times vary considerably depending on your selected withdrawal method and the operator’s internal procedures. E-wallets typically offer the quickest payouts in 24-48 hours, while bank transfers may take 3-5 business days to be completed. Review the operator’s conditions concerning waiting periods, payout caps, and any restrictions on bonus-related winnings prior to selecting a site for your gaming needs.
